car keeps overheating
I just had a b16 installed into my 95 civic si and my car overheats every two days.
Sometimes while driving you can hear a pshhhh noise, i assume its coolant leaking out from somewhere. I can not see any coolant leaking from anywhere. But after it overheats and i let it cool down the rad takes a whole bunch coolant.
When the car is at normal operating temp both the upper and lower rad hoses are hot...so its not the thermostat. Also the fan does not work (after the swap). I jumped the thermoswitch with a wire and the fan turned on. So i believe the thermoswitch is bad. But would that cause my car to overheat? Plus where is the coolant going?
Oh yeah, there is NO coolant in the oil and my car doesn't puff white smoke. So far i think that its a pin hole in one of the rad hoses somewhere. Anyone have any ideas?
